Is There a Killer in Mrs Norris’s House? by Nicole J. Simms

‘Is There a Killer in Mrs Norris’s House?’ is a 1316-word short story. The story is told in the second person, and you are the main character of the story. While on your way to a Halloween party, you spot a person who could be the Jack O’ Lantern Killer in Mrs Norris’s house. Will you save Mrs Norris?

The story was written for Tales from the Moonlit Path’s Halloween Special Edition Challenge. I had originally written the story in the third person, but after reading a story in the second person, I decided to try writing the story in the second person.

I didn’t win the competition, but I was given an honourable mention, and my story was published on the website. This was a brilliant achievement for me because it’s the first published story since I became ill.
